grafana change panel color

Without support for variables in transformations , the CSV plugin itself needs to support filtering. The colors for each type are close enough you can get a good representation of how the pool is doing on cpu overall, but they are different enough that you can also tell if one host or cpu is struggling . Using Kolmogorov complexity to measure difficulty of problems? Hide some panel by specific value of a variable. Theoretically Correct vs Practical Notation. We make it interactive opinion ; back them up with references or experience! Why does Grafana double the sub-page within the URL on certain links? Server select into variable language that was developed for scripting, ETL, and! To show data in a table layout, use the Table visualization. Grafana now ships with an included Pie chart visualization. You can imagine that if all of our certificates are healthy, then there's only one column being filled in with green and all the other columns are red. This works but I have a dashboard that has a variable to select a servername from an automatically updated drop down list. Note: Repeating panels require variables to have one or more items selected; you cannot repeat a panel zero times to hide it. Sobota - Nieczynne, Godziny pracy: Well demo all the highlights of the major release: new and updated visualizations and themes, data source improvements, and Enterprise features. Is a PhD visitor considered as a visiting scholar? This would be preferable to a hack to allow template variables to work with alerting since it prevents the possibility of a user from removing hosts from a template selection and thus disabling alerting.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Asking for help, clarification, or responding to other answers.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, Although the answer is not very specific it guides you in the right direction if you're willing to experiment a little. I have tried to go through documentation but have not found a way to do it. These are the sample of Prometheus data: Here, we select our variables data source, which is the database that the query will execute against. Open the dashboard that contains the panel. You should use the variable in your query condition as you used for the panel repeating. This is so annoying - is there a place I can just hardcore a hex color value against that field? For example, dashboard-level variable may be used to select some "Categories". Jordan's line about intimate parties in The Great Gatsby? Euler: A baby on his lap, a cat on his back thats how he wrote his immortal works (origin? To show value distribution over, time use the heatmap visualization. hotels . Why is this needed: Using repeat panel option can't be the solution because it just dynamically creates new panels. Clarks Women's Ashland Lane Q Loafer, Analytics and Insights. By clicking Sign up for GitHub, you agree to our terms of service and Have a question about this project? Calculating probabilities from d6 dice pool (Degenesis rules for botches and triggers). 1 = (red) 2 = (blue) 3 = (yellow) So then if there's 1 line in a graph it's going to be red. bowel pressure on bladder; wdiv meteorologist fired; strands light bar; bnha ao3 recommendations; never saint cheat code. Is it suspicious or odd to stand by the gate of a GA airport watching the planes? graph was shown. Next, lets define how we will select our variable. To create a new variable, go to your Grafana dashboard settings, navigate to the Variable option in the side-menu, and then click the Add variable button. I grafana variable only for panel # x27 ; variables & # x27 ; tab on the left side bar, are! (Optional) In Label, enter the display name of the variable dropdown. Agree with everyone above. I should be able to set Grafana Labs uses cookies for the normal operation of this website. My code is GPL licensed, can I issue a license to have my code be distributed in a specific MIT licensed project? Here are a few newer docs resources. How can I set defaults for those variables per panel/chart and not only globally for the whole dashboard? Heres what my panel looks like before we make it interactive. I would like to plot all this data as 4 different lines on a line chart. This is so annoying - is there a place I can just hardcore a hex color value against that field? Method 2: Color Panel Color Mode. a. Edit the panel to which you want to add a threshold. The text was updated successfully, but these errors were encountered: would love to see banded rows, currently one of our biggest reasons for not switching to grafana from other solutions, need very readable dashboards. https://community.grafana.com/t/is-grafana-7-0-missing-row-color-modes/30526/2, other people seem to be infected for the row table color issue, Yeah, Grafana had that in version 6 and it's been very useful for our org. A threshold is a value that you specify for a metric that is visually reflected in a dashboard when the threshold value is met or exceeded. OK, I couldnt figure out what the answer is. More information in the Grafana docs: https://grafana.com/docs/reference/templating/. Upper Back Pain And Mucus In Throat, Pobierz teraz Our color scheme is set to "from thresholds (by value)" and our cell display mode is set to "color background". Find centralized, trusted content and collaborate around the technologies you use most. So far i've gone with editing the core Tables plugin for raising a pull request, however if this isn't likely to be accepted it may well be worth branching to a new plugin. In this step, we modify our query to use the variable we created in Step 1. Just a suggestion off of this topic: See. Only when I return the the server that was in view when I changed it does the new color appear. Auto-Generated Headers yesoreyeram/grafana to how to use Prometheus snmp_exporter to gather metrics for Cisco switches and use repeated! If you want to present a value as it relates to a min and max value you have two options. You can do that with the Overrides panel. For what its worth, I am using Grafana v7.4.3, Powered by Discourse, best viewed with JavaScript enabled. If you have additional questions, please create a new post. Well demo all the highlights of the major release: new and updated visualizations and themes, data source improvements, and Enterprise features. How to follow the signal when reading the schematic? I also see that How to Customize Your Grafana Theme recommends editing the _variables.dark.scss file, however I cannot see where this is located, as it is not in the public/sass directory as the post suggests. Dalsze korzystanie ze strony oznacza, e zgadzasz si na ich uycie. Reason you do n't see any values in your query condition as you used for the panel the! grafana-cli plugins install yesoreyeram-boomtheme-panel service grafana-server restart Go to certain Dashboard and add new Panel. Landi > Bez kategorii > grafana variable only for panel. How to handle a hobby that makes income in US. Your color scheme will by default be set to the same color . To learn more, see our tips on writing great answers. The Boom Theme plugin documentation is here: https://github.com/yesoreyeram/yesoreyeram-boomtheme-panel/tree/master/docs Documentation no longer exists, see the GitHub readme file instead. Downloads. Having a quick look into this, no promises i'll be able to get anything working as i'm not that familiar with reactjs Is there an easy way to make a new plugin which uses one of the core plugins as it's base code then overrides and extends classes/functionality where needed? What do you do in order to drag out lectures? It is generally the "good" color. The color choice popup happens, but clicks are ignored. If you RSVP and cant attend live, no worries. Create a new override, match the field by the name of the column and add a Treshold, that is all! This post gives you step-by-step demos and shows you how to create 6 different visuals for DevOps, IoT, geospatial, and public data use cases (and beyond), as well as answers to common questions about building visuals in Grafana. critical = red. The fastest way to get started is with Grafana Cloud, which includes free forever access to 10k metrics, 50GB logs, 50GB traces, & more. Does a barbarian benefit from the fast movement ability while wearing medium armor? 1995 Ethiopian Constitution Pdf, In case you are embedding Grafana's dashboard/panel, check for "allow_embedding = true" under "[security]" section in grafana.ini and use &kiosk parameter in a URL to avoid menus. * against * Jesus calming the storm meaning Jesus = God Almighty learn more see! https://grafana.com/docs/reference/templating/. Ill illustrate the process using the example of monitoring the live locations of buses going on different routes in New York City, but the steps I follow will work for any scenario. Those of us that work with data often want to make useful dashboards that make it easier for ourselves and other people within our team and organization, to gain insight and make sense of the data we collect. Influxdb offers a fourth generation programming language that was developed for scripting, ETL, monitoring and alerting a location Github account to open an issue and contact its maintainers and the community retail! You can also see from the annotations API documentation that it's not possible yet. Delete a threshold when it is no longer relevant to your business operations. P.S. Additional helpful documentation, links, and articles: Opening keynote: What's new in Grafana 9? What Is the Difference Between 'Man' And 'Son of Man' in Num 23:19? On the Variables tab, choose New . 2 I have a grafana table which shows max, min, avg and std.dev. Looking forward to the discussion! As a novice coming here for help, this thread was very useful in trying to replicate a split by series / split chart from Kibana. Im aware this is not secure, and the user can still get to the sidebar links, however our grafana sites are internal access only and users access via a VPN. rev2023.3.3.43278. The instructions are here in the GitHub repo setup: grafana 3.1.1. datatsource: graphite. Email update@grafana.com for help. I open this issue over this one. Making statements based on opinion; back them up with references or personal experience. * you simply allow any value as a regular expression. Ill make sure you get the recording and resources shortly following the session. For example, it can be name of cities. The difference between the phonemes /p/ and /b/ in Japanese, Calculating probabilities from d6 dice pool (Degenesis rules for botches and triggers), How to tell which packages are held back due to phased updates. @grant2 yep, that does clarify things for me, thank you! On the display options pane, click Panel options > Repeat options. rev2023.3.3.43278. And share knowledge within a single location that is structured and easy search. Over 2 million developers have joined DZone. For more information about scheme, refer to Scheme gradient mode. We define a variable, and then when we reference it, were referring to the thing we defined the variable as. Additional helpful documentation, links, and articles: Opening keynote: What's new in Grafana 9? Has 90% of ice around Antarctica disappeared in less than a decade? A Grafana panel is the user interface you use to define a data source query, and transform and format data that appears in visualizations. Is there a proper earth ground point in this switch box? Variables simply do not use the example of visualizing the real-time location in new York City, using from Everything from how to visualize geo-spatial data using a World Map panel setup, below Transportation Authority think this feature would big a huge new set in the rest of this post i. Can you mock up this problem for others to try and solve using dummy data? You signed in with another tab or window. Making statements based on opinion; back them up with references or personal experience. Your preferences will apply to this website only. Thanks for contributing an answer to Stack Overflow! Note: By signing up, you agree to be emailed related product-level information. In the panel display options pane, locate the Panel options section. 2022-11-09 . When you say the color choice popup happens, does it look like this? Each element by index of their position something like: is this ok uses the HTTP api to sync variables! Burt county fair 2022 low dose amitriptyline and dementia top 50 n64 rom SQL. Avoid downtime. Create free account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, Grafana Timeseries Panel: How to change color of annotations bar based on a tag, How Intuit democratizes AI development across teams through reusability.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. Join the DZone community and get the full member experience. The difference between the phonemes /p/ and /b/ in Japanese, How to handle a hobby that makes income in US, Partner is not responding when their writing is needed in European project application. # x27 ; t find any way related recommendations ; never saint cheat.! Would be really nice to have a color palette per-query.. I am using Grafana version 8.1.0 and have a timeseries panel on which annotations are added using HTTP create annotation API and GUI both. Note: By signing up, you agree to be emailed related product-level information. The nature of simulating nature: A Q&A with IBM Quantum researcher Dr. Jamie We've added a "Necessary cookies only" option to the cookie consent popup. In dashboard settings I found Variables, thank you. *' to hide the rest - a very important feature that seems to also have been removed. In this case, we use the Query type, where our variable will be defined as the result of an SQL query. An all option to quickly select all the repeated panels for displaying rather than selecting one Click the $ payment_types variable of color in Enola Holmes movies historically?. Grafana Labs employees rate the overall compensation and benefits package 4.5/5 stars. In the rest of this post, I will show you how to use Grafanas variables feature to build your own interactive dashboards. You can write some code yourself that uses the HTTP api to sync template variables across many dashboards raleigh county housing authority. Before running you will want to make some changes to. I am trying to use variables in transformations, the Graphite Template Nested example on Use grafana variable only for panel in metric queries and in panel titles use variables in,! Are you working on solving the problem with colorize rows in table panel? How to color table in Grafana based on individual column values? Time arrow with "current position" evolving with overlay number. The color choice popup happens, but clicks are ignored. You can also explore play.grafana.org which has a large set of demo dashboards that showcase all the different visualizations. To install a plugin use the following steps. 2022 2013 kx65 value burt county fair 2022 low dose amitriptyline and dementia top 50 n64 rom pack sql server select into variable. * against * Jesus calming the storm meaning Jesus = God Almighty or Jesus = God Almighty variables, thank you where dashboard-level variables simply do not use the variable is defined Powered by Discourse, best viewed with JavaScript enabled simply do not provide the granularity needed to convey information the! To delete a threshold, navigate to the panel that contains the threshold and click the trash icon next to the threshold you want to remove. An Introduction to the Graph Panel. However kiosk mode + variables drop-down only, is such a clean, simple UI). Select a category variable (field) and let users set colors for each value and colorize whole row. I have 4 different sensors producing temperature data into MySQL db. It seems this is saving the color choice by the name of the series instead of it just being saved as the color for the first series in this panel. Navigate to the graph panel to which you want to add a threshold. When the migration is complete, you will access your Teams at stackoverflowteams.com, and they will no longer appear in the left sidebar on stackoverflow.com. all our tutorials, tips, and click the payment_types A Template variable pack SQL server select into variable [ 0 ] will To support filtering the real-time location in new York City, using from. Or worse, stakeholders try to dig into the code and accidentally break things! Dashboard variables aren't useful for this, because you'd like to set each panel independently, and it would result in an unmanageable and confusing number of similarly-named variables. Lumpen Radio is a project of Public Media Institute a registered 501 (c) non-profit organization. Why is this sentence from The Great Gatsby grammatical? I'm not familiar with grafana internals, but here's what I imagine needs to be done: These are roughly in the order they should be implemented. To see variable settings, navigate to Dashboard Settings > Variables. To appear to specific panel the query, we then save our changes and check if variable! Settings used to create our route variable. How to prove that the supernatural or paranormal doesn't exist? Mobile app infrastructure being decommissioned, grafana variable still catch old metrics info, PromQL metric query returning other metrics than what I want, Prometheus filter query result using lables in result, Wrong value on cpu usage from Node Exporter.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. For more information about repeating rows, refer to Configure repeating rows. To see an example of repeating panels, refer to Prometheus dashboard with repeating panels. Panel titles and metric queries can refer to variables using two different syntaxes: $varname This syntax is easy to read, but it does not allow you to use a variable in the middle of a word. You can apply thresholds to most, but not all, visualizations. Neither of those are as important to our current use cases as the regression involving coloring a row based on a field. Variables dynamically change your queries across all panels in a dashboard. Values can be text or numeric. , those are the human-readable descriptors that appear next to your dashboards drop-down ( ). Click in the panel title and select Inspect > Panel JSON.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. If you change it to . Why do small African island nations perform better than African continental nations, considering democracy and human development? Why is this the case? You can set different rules for colors in graphs this way based on values. Avoid downtime. First a standard Radial Gauge shown below. How to add Time series queries with grafana and MySQL? Sign up for a free GitHub account to open an issue and contact its maintainers and the community. Section 2 of this is a regression from Grafana v6, where that option was easy and in v7 appears no longer possible. You can download the JSON to replicate the dashboard in this Github repo. Open the dashboard that contains the panel you want to edit. I think table panel is very important yet very limited compared to other features grafana provides. Im going to use the example of visualizing the real-time location in New York City, using data from the Metropolitan Transportation Authority. Use Grafana to turn failure into resilience. This public demo dashboard contains many different examples for how this visualization can be configured and styled. This section of the documentation highlights the built-in panels, their options and typical usage. You can change your preferences at any time by returning to this site or . Finally, I also see that _variables.dark.generated.scss tells you to Edit grafana-ui/src/themes/_variables.dark.scss.tmpl.ts to update template, however I cannot find that file either. Default thresholds On visualizations that support it, Grafana sets default threshold values of: 80 = red Base = green Mode = Absolute The Base value represents minus infinity.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Iowa State Penitentiary Famous Inmates, Clinton, Iowa Recycling Schedule, Tenerife Music Festival 2022, Do You Capitalize The Name Of A Program, Ronelle Williams Leaving Ksn, Articles G

grafana change panel color